Handover: per-tenant rate quotas (Tollgate service)

Welcome aboard! Quick rundown: quotas live in the tollgate-config repo, enforced at the edge by the Latchkey proxy. Each tenant gets a base bucket plus burst allowance; overrides go through a YAML file, not the admin UI (the UI lies, ignore it). Don't touch the shared default tier without a heads-up — three big tenants depend on it. For approvals and anything confusing, ping the person listed below.

named custodian: Brivan Eliath Quenox Frador

## Deploying the Gatewick Proctor Queue

Deploys are pretty painless: push to main, wait for the pipeline, then watch the queue drain dashboard for five minutes. If candidates pile up mid-exam, roll back first and ask questions later — the queue replays safely. Everything the workers care about lives in one config block, shown here for reference.

settings of bafof-yagef:
JOROX_PIN=8740
JOROX_TENANT=pelox
JOROX_METRICS_HOST=metrics.jorox.qorvelworks.internal
JOROX_SEAL=seal_c78f63c1
JOROX_STANDBY_TEAM=norax

### Retention Sweeper API

The Grailkeeper sweeper deletes records past their retention window nightly at 02:00 UTC. Support can query `/sweeps/recent` to confirm whether a customer's data was removed by policy versus by error. Dry-run results are retained for 30 days. All sweeper endpoints require service authentication, and requests without it return 401. Authenticate using the key below.

API key for yahig-tadup: kto7_ubizbYm

Release checklist — Portionary recipe-scaling calculator, plugin channel:

- Confirm scaling factors round-trip for fractional units (thirds, eighths).
- Verify the plugin API shim rejects negative serving counts.
- Run the conversion table against the frozen fixture set; zero deltas allowed.
- Bump the compat manifest so third-party plugins fail loudly, not silently.
- Tag and sign the artifact.

Do not publish until every box is checked. Record the signed artifact against the build identifier below.

session token of tajef-bageg = htk21_5d90d574934f3ccae6437